OPERATION
_,
BOAT
MOUNTING
a.
Mount
the motor
on the center
of the boat
transom
{stern).
(See Figure 4),
CAUTION
Hand
tighten
clamp
bracket
clamp
stud
h0nd!_ _imuit0ne0u_ly,
Do not use a
wrench
or any
other
device
that would
cause damage
to
brackets,
Occasionally
check
to
be
sure
lamp
stud
handles
on
transom
mounting
bracket
are
tight,
(See Figure 5).
b.
To obtain
the
best performance
from
your
outboard,
the following
boat transom
speci-
fications
are recommended:
{See Figure 4),
Transom
Angle
(See View
3}:
.............
12 to 15 degrees
Transom
Height
(See view
4):
............
_ . .20.7
inches
c,
The
angle
of
the
motor
column
is easily
adjusted
by
removing
the
Hitch
Pin
and
changing
the
Tilt
Lock
Bracket
Pin in the
three
(3)
different
angle-
position
holes
located
on
either
side of the right
or left
Transom
Mounting
Brackets.
Each
angle
position
elevates
five
(5)
degrees.
Try
center hole position
first.
(See Figure 6).
d.
To
find the
cot(act
angle
position,
make a
test
Pun
at
full
throttle
with
your
usual
loading
in the boat.
Always
stop motor
to
change the Tilt
Lock
Bracket
Pin,
The cor-
rect
angle
position
wil{
have
your
boat
traveling
with
the bow
slightly
higher than
the
stern,
but
should
not
porpoise
{bow
rises and falls rapidly
and continuously):
Be
sure Tilt
Lock Bracket
Pin is always
pushed
completely
through
both
Transom
Mount-
ing Brackets
and Hitch
Pin is secured.'
WARNING
If the motor
column
is tiited
too far out-
ward,
the
boat
is likely
to
porpoise
or
cavitate
at
full
throttle,
which
can
be
dangerous
because
a cross wind
or a wave
could
suddenly
deflect
the
boat into
a
dangerous
turn.
Als0,
if
the
motor
column
is tilted
too
far inward,
the bow
of
the
boat
will
dig
in,
which
can
be
dangerous
when
crossing
a wake
or
in
rough
water.
Do
not
run
motor
in the
storage
position.
(See
View
t
and
2,
Figure 4).
e.
,_ecura motor
to
boat
with
Safety
Chain.
Chain
not included
with motor.

STEERING
ADJUSTMENT
Tighten
steering
tension
screw
using a screw-
driver
for desired
steering effort,
(See Figure 6).
CAUTION
1
J There
is a possibility
Of losing
screw
if
backed
out too far,
